Which capital city was formerly known as Bytown?

Ottawa, the capital city of Canada, was formerly known as Bytown. The name was changed to Ottawa in 1855 when it was incorporated as a city.


How did brampton get the name brampton?

The city of Brampton, Canada got its name from Brampton, England. It was incorporated as a village in 1853 and was known as The Flower Town of Canada because it had a huge greenhouse industry.

Which was 1st Toronto on or Toronto oh?

The City of Toronto, in the colony of Upper Canada, was incorporated on March 6, 1834, but the area had been known as Toronto as early as 1615 when it was visited by Étienne Brûlé. Toronto, Ohio, was incorporated in 1881 and was named after Toronto, Ontario (formerly Upper Canada), because civic leader Thomas M. Daniels felt Toronto, Ontario, was "a place worth emulating."
